Factors Affecting Game Length

Now, here’s where things get interesting. The end time of a Dodgers game isn't always set in stone. Several factors can influence how long a game lasts. The average MLB game lasts around 3 hours, but this can fluctuate.

  • Number of Innings: Most games go for nine innings, but sometimes a game might go into extra innings to determine a winner. Obviously, extra innings can add significant time to the game.
  • Pitching Changes: A flurry of pitching changes can slow things down. Every time a new pitcher comes in, there's a short break, which adds up over the course of the game.
  • Offensive Production: If there are a lot of hits, runs, and walks, the game tends to take longer. Base runners and scoring opportunities mean more time for action.
  • Reviewing Plays: Instant replay reviews, which are more common now, add extra time. Umpires sometimes need to review close calls, which pauses the game.
  • Delays: Weather delays, such as rain or lightning, can also push the end time way back. These delays can be short or last for hours, depending on the severity of the weather.

Fun Facts About Dodgers Games

Here are some fun facts to make your Dodgers game experience even better:

  • Dodger Dogs: No Dodgers game is complete without a Dodger Dog! Over two million Dodger Dogs are sold each season at Dodger Stadium, making them a true Los Angeles icon. If you're going to a game, make sure you grab one!
  • The Seventh-Inning Stretch: The seventh-inning stretch is a beloved tradition at baseball games, including Dodgers games. Fans stand up, stretch, and sing “Take Me Out to the Ballgame.”
  • Dodger Stadium: Dodger Stadium is one of the oldest and most iconic stadiums in Major League Baseball. It offers stunning views, especially during sunset games.
  • Fan Traditions: Dodgers fans have their own traditions, like chanting “Let’s Go Dodgers!” and wearing the iconic blue and white. Being part of these traditions makes the game experience special.
  • Game Day Traffic: Remember that traffic near Dodger Stadium can be heavy, especially before and after games. Plan accordingly and consider using public transportation or arriving early to avoid delays.
